Currently when collapsing project or folders the predecessor lines referenced to that project/folder just disappear.
My suggestion is to have all the predecessor lines instead of disappearing point to the beginning or end of the project/folder time line, essentially move up the hierarchy
Having them disappear as they do now make is easy to miss dependencies if a specific project happens to be collapsed. This would also be helpful to see dependencies at the project level